fix(providers/openai): bound tiktoken vocab loads with the guarded loader (#2554)
## Description

`headroom/providers/openai.py::_get_encoding` calls
`tiktoken.get_encoding` directly. tiktoken downloads missing
vocabularies via `requests.get` with **no timeout**, so on a network
that blackholes the vocab CDN (corporate firewall, SSL-intercepting
proxy), whichever thread first counts tokens for an OpenAI model — proxy
startup included — blocks indefinitely.

This is the provider-path hole left by #956: the tokenizer registry
already routes through a bounded loader
(`headroom/tokenizers/tiktoken_counter.py`, worker-thread load +
`HEADROOM_TIKTOKEN_LOAD_TIMEOUT_SECONDS`, default 10s) and falls back to
estimation, but the OpenAI provider path never got the same treatment.

Observed in production (Headroom Desktop fleet, Sentry): a proxy that
never finished booting, with a faulthandler dump wedged in
`tiktoken/registry.py` `get_encoding` on the main thread, reached from
the `headroom` CLI entrypoint via click. The desktop app now also
pre-seeds a persistent `TIKTOKEN_CACHE_DIR`, but the unbounded load
affects every deployment of the proxy, so it should be fixed here too.

Follow-up to #956.

## Changes Made

- `_get_encoding` now routes through the bounded `load_encoding` from
`headroom.tokenizers.tiktoken_counter` instead of calling
`tiktoken.get_encoding` directly, so a stalled vocab download raises
`TiktokenLoadError` after the timeout instead of hanging the calling
thread.
- `OpenAIProvider.get_token_counter` catches `TiktokenLoadError` and
falls back to `EstimatingTokenCounter`, cached per model so later
requests never re-block on the same failed download — mirroring
`TokenizerRegistry._create_tiktoken`.
- `TIKTOKEN_AVAILABLE` uses `importlib.util.find_spec` (the module-level
`import tiktoken` became unused; same pattern as `LITELLM_AVAILABLE`).
- Two regression tests (`TestGuardedEncodingLoad`) covering the
bounded-raise path and the cached estimation fallback.

## Real Behavior Proof

- Environment: macOS (arm64), Python 3.12, uv-managed venv, branch off
`upstream/main` (a6d4921e).
- Exact command / steps: the stalled download is simulated in
`TestGuardedEncodingLoad` by monkeypatching
`tiktoken_counter.load_encoding` to raise `TiktokenLoadError`;
`OpenAITokenCounter("gpt-4o")` then raises the bounded error, and
`OpenAIProvider.get_token_counter("gpt-4o")` returns a working
`EstimatingTokenCounter` and reuses the same instance on the second
call.
- Observed result: tests pass (see output above); with an empty tiktoken
on-disk cache, the encoding load path is identical to the one in the
production faulthandler dump.
- Not tested: an end-to-end run against a genuinely blackholed vocab CDN
(needs a firewalled network); the timeout mechanism itself is #956's
code, already covered by its own tests.

## Additional Notes

The estimation fallback is sticky for the process lifetime (per-model
cache + the loader's fail-fast set from #956): a network that recovers
mid-session keeps estimation until restart. That matches the registry's
existing behavior, so no new divergence is introduced.
